What is a Pallet Jack?

A pallet jack is a tool commonly used in factories, warehouses and storerooms to lift and move pallets wooden pallets that contain goods or equipment. While it’s one of the most efficient, cost-effective ways to transport heavy loads over short distances, understanding how to use a pallet jack properly is key to ensuring safety and efficiency.

How Do Pallet Jacks Work?

Pallet jacks operate by using a hydraulic pump system, which lifts the forks to raise the pallet. This is powered by either manual effort or electricity, depending on the type of pallet jack.

For manual models, the operator pumps the handle to lift the forks, while an electric pallet jack uses a motor to lift and drive the unit. Pallet jacks also feature wheels and a handle, so you can easily move it by pushing or driving the jack across the floor.

How to Use a Pallet Jack?

Whether you’re in a warehouse, retail space, or factory, knowing how to use a pallet jack properly can make your workflow more efficient, reduce the risk of injury, and make heavy lifting tasks easier. Operating a pallet jack is straightforward:

  1. Using the Forks: First, position the forks to go under the pallet you’d like to lift.
  2. Lift the Load: For manual pallet jacks, pump the handle to lift the forks until it lifts the pallet off the ground. For electric pallet jacks, press the control button to raise the forks.
  3. Move the Pallet: Once the pallet is lifted, push or drive the pallet jack to wherever you’d like it to go.
  4. Lower the Load: To lower the pallet, use the release lever on manual jacks or control buttons on electric jacks.
